Houston-born artist Jesse de Leon transforms life experiences into captivating works of art. From an early age, his passion for creativity was evident, leading him to craft banners and murals during his school years. This early encouragement evolved into a professional career that spans impressionism, abstraction, and the versatile use of materials to explore themes of culture, music, and human connection. Jesse de Leon’s work blends meticulous detail with an innovative approach to mediums, ranging from canvas to wood to large-scale murals. His art serves as both a personal reflection and an invitation for viewers to see the world from new perspectives. A dedicated educator and humanitarian, de Leon travels annually to Haiti to teach and inspire students, using his murals to bring hope and beauty to impoverished communities. Rooted in his belief that art is both therapy and communication, de Leon’s creations resonate with curiosity, emotion, and inspiration. His versatility and dedication to his craft continue to push boundaries, making his work a dynamic addition to the contemporary art world.
